Output 3d86afea8df422ada6eec1aed6727e7b18ae01c705262f1ded88bb3645c17f61:7

value
5018300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1631e145779576a6e20985c069e5a14a001cb3bf OP_EQUAL
address
33iNYV5EpFSccZ8fBwoRuRr73vN7d2UDaU
transaction
3d86afea8df422ada6eec1aed6727e7b18ae01c705262f1ded88bb3645c17f61
spent
true